The following are the ten provinces with the highest import value of various non-precious metal goods from HS code 83 ports in March 2025:
* DKI Jakarta US$35.66 million
* East Java US$7.05 million
* Riau Islands US$6.43 million
* Banten US$5.4 million
* Central Java US$4.64 million
* Central Sulawesi US$1.15 million
* West Java US$895,960
* North Sumatra US$882,880
* North Maluku US$582,890
* Lampung US$492,490
